The High Cost of Eyeglasses: Uncovering the Factors
Glasses can feel expensive, causing many to wonder about the motivations behind their cost. Several factors contribute to the value of eyeglasses, ranging from the materials used to the expertise required for adjustment.
- {Firstly|First|, the type of lenses chosen has a significant impact on price. Higher-index lenses, which are thinner and lighter, are generally more expensive than standard lenses.
